Grasping the Methods of Deterioration and Protective Coating Formation

Corrosion is a detrimental process that results the gradual deterioration of materials, primarily metals, due to interactions with their surrounding environment. This deterioration can manifest as tarnishing, pitting, or mechanical weakening. Understanding the fundamental principles behind corrosion is crucial for creating effective control strategies.

Shielding films play a crucial role in withstanding corrosion by providing a mechanical obstacle between the susceptible material and the corrosive environment. These coatings can be deposited through various methods, such as anodizing. The effectiveness of a barrier layer relies on its properties, thickness, and ability to attach firmly to the underlying material.

Research in this field focuses on investigating the complex interplay between materials, environmental influences, and corrosion processes. This knowledge is essential for designing durable materials that can withstand corrosive situations and extend the lifespan of structures.

Durability Testing of Corrosion-Resistant Coatings: Methodologies and Results

Durability testing plays a essential role in evaluating the performance of corrosion-resistant coatings. Various methodologies are employed to assess the resistance of these coatings to environmental attack. Common techniques include salt spray tests, which simulate real-world conditions to evaluate coating performance over time. The results of these tests provide valuable insights into the longevity of coatings, enabling manufacturers and engineers to make informed decisions regarding material selection and application strategies.

Ultimately, the goal of durability testing is to ensure that corrosion-resistant coatings provide long-term protection against the damaging effects of corrosion in a variety of demanding environments.
